What Is a Walker with Seat?
A walker with a seat is a mobility aid developed for individuals who might require help while walking however likewise need the option to rest often. These walkers normally feature four legs, sturdy deals with for grip, and an integrated seat that permits the user to take breaks as necessary. The style of these devices differs, using alternatives that cater to different preferences and needs.

Picking the Right Walker with Seat
Choosing the proper walker with a seat includes thinking about numerous aspects to ensure it meets the user's needs. Here's a checklist to help in picking the best walker with seat:
Considerations for Selection
User's Physical Condition: Assess the physical capabilities and limitations of the user. Are they able to handle their weight with the walker? Do they require more stability?
Weight Capacity: Ensure that the walker can support the user's weight comfortably. Most walkers have particular weight limitations.
Mobility: For those who prepare to travel or move often, consider the weight and foldability of the walker.
User Preferences: Users might have specific choices concerning design, color, or extra functions that deal with their lifestyle.
Spending plan: Walkers with seats can differ in rate based on products and functions. It's essential to choose one that fulfills the necessary requirements without going beyond the budget plan.

Can individuals use walkers with seats if they have restricted upper body strength?
Yes, walkers with seats are created to provide assistance and stability for individuals with numerous strength levels. Choosing a model with sturdy handgrips and brakes can boost safety.
2. Are walkers with seats suitable for outdoor use?
Absolutely. The majority of walkers with seats are designed for both indoor and outdoor use. Nevertheless, it is recommended to choose designs with larger wheels for better maneuverability on outdoor surfaces.
3. How do I keep a walker with a seat?
Routinely check the rubber suggestions for wear, guarantee that all moving parts are working properly, and tidy the walker to avoid dirt buildup. If any elements are harmed, change them immediately.
4. How can I enhance my walking ability while utilizing a walker with a seat?
Regular physical treatment and balance workouts can help improve strength and coordination, helping in much better mobility even when utilizing a walker.
5. Is it possible to change the height of walkers with seats?
The majority of modern walkers with seats include adjustable heights for the handles to accommodate different user heights, making sure comfort and appropriate posture.
